Searches related to dell laptop computers for sale on amazon store locations near me today
1.
dell laptop computers for sale on amazon store locations near me today map
2.
dell laptop computers for sale on amazon store locations near me today open
3.
dell laptop computers for sale on amazon store locations near me today live
4.
dell laptop computers for sale on amazon store locations near me today show







